Output 31dbefb657cb892f2694731007ce8d6aaa5f82141a5c8c387006fc6540ede850:2

value
29367000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b16d863704cf73bd9199b367f0707a5110ee50fc OP_EQUAL
address
3HsAjNsZXWkzz91nGgmzbUuKFGBq2zUTxa
transaction
31dbefb657cb892f2694731007ce8d6aaa5f82141a5c8c387006fc6540ede850
spent
true